When to use your Walker :
• Your baby should be able to sit unaided and be able to support most of his/her
legs (about 6 months old).
• Both feet should be able to touch the floor.
• When you are able to watch your baby at all times while playing in the activity center.
• When you have prepared your baby’s play space according to these guidelines.
When NOT to use your Walker :
• Do not use until your child can sit up alone.
• When your child can walk unaided.
• When your child reaches 13.5 kg in weight.
• When your child has grown over 80 cm in height.
• If your activity center has become broken or damaged.
• If you haven’t prepared a safe play space for your baby.
• If the tray of your activity center is lower than your baby’s waist leve when your
child stands in the activity center.
• If you haven’t blocked access to stairs and steps.
• If you haven’t assembled the activity center according to these instructions.
Other things to avoid :
• Don’t lift or carry your baby in the activity center.
• Don’t adjust the activity center with your baby in it.
• Don’t use the activity center if iit is broken or damaged.
• Don’t use the activity center with your child in it on a table or countertop.
• Keep dangling electrical cords out of baby’s reach, such as an iron on an ironing
board, lamp cords, etc.
